Treatment Experience

Does acupuncture hurt?

Most people describe acupuncture as gentle. You may notice a brief sensation at some points, and treatment can be adjusted to your comfort level.

How many sessions will I need?

This depends on your concern, history and response to care. Your practitioner will discuss a sensible plan after the first appointment.

Safety

Is acupuncture safe?

Acupuncture is generally considered safe when performed by a trained practitioner using sterile single-use needles. Your health history is reviewed before treatment.

Can acupuncture replace medical care?

No. Website information and acupuncture care do not replace diagnosis or treatment from your GP, specialist or emergency care provider.
